A Vision for the Dining Room
The transformation our friend envisioned centered significantly around the dining room, where she proposed the introduction of Roman shades. These elegantly simple window treatments promised not just aesthetic enhancement but practical benefits:
- Uniquely Stylish: The possibility of matching the shades with the dining table cloth was too good an opportunity to miss, promising a cohesive elegance that complemented our antique dining set.
- Custom-Fit Solution: Our home's non-standard sized windows posed a challenge that Roman shades, with their customizable nature, easily overcame.
- Highlighting Craftsmanship: Our painstakingly restored native oak woodwork deserved to shine, unobscured by bulky curtains or drapes.
- Cost Efficiency: With our friend's talent in making curtains and shades, opting for DIY Roman shades was both a budget-friendly and personalized choice.
The Essence of Roman Shades
Roman shades combine functionality with aesthetics in a design that's both practical and visually appealing. Capable of fitting within the frames of non-standard windows, these shades rise in even folds, thanks to a system of rings, cords, and horizontal battens. Opting to line the shades, our friend added an extra layer of insulation against the cold, turning these window treatments into guardians against winter's chill.
Where Roman Shades Shine
These versatile shades find their place in any room, offering privacy, light control, and a dash of elegance. Whether used in a bedroom for a restful ambiance or paired with drapes in a dining room for formal sophistication, Roman shades adapt seamlessly to their surroundings.
